Impact:


SZC Project Controls will serve as a centre of excellence, managing and strategically using delivery performance management information. Our team will enable successful delivery of SZC Project through proactive Project Controls that drives forward-looking solutions to continuously improve performance. As a Risk Manager, you will be working within the Project Management Office (PMO) and will support/ be deployed with one of SZC's delivery programmes.


Your role will be to support the operation of all PMO risk processes across SZC, reporting to a Senior Risk Manager. This will entail supporting the ownership, deployment, and continuous improvement of all the PMO risk process elements of one of SZC's delivery programmes whilst helping to ensure we operate and deliver controls within the SZC governance structure, organisation and delivery model. They will help ensure PMO risk activities being carried out in an efficient manner in accordance with calendars and deadlines established on SZC.

Principal Accountabilities, Activities and Decisions
  • Support the Senior Risk Manager in operating Integrated Project Controls (Risk) processes.
  • Support with tasks directed by the Senior Risk Manager, and the ability to deputise at key delivery programme meetings.
  • Support the Senior Risk Manager with the planning & co-ordination of risk activities such as EAC update, ERR preparation, Integrated-QRA development etc.
  • Support the Senior Risk Manager with progress reporting including monthly risk dashboard updates, forecast to complete, variance identification, delivery process insights and opportunities for improvement.
